Single ion maps 3D electromagnetic fields above chips with record sensitivity

Дата публикации: 02-07-2026 22:20:04

Researchers at ETH Zurich have developed a method that uses a single ion to detect electromagnetic fields above a surface and to create a three-dimensional map of them. In the future, this approach can be used to improve chips for quantum computers and quantum sensors.
